what do you mean the gti feels more nimble and quicker?? theyre the same car!
the engines are identical except for the badge, and the rear of a gti has a 24mm (i think) antiroll bar, as opposed to a 21mm(i think) saxo one which you wouldnt really notice on most days.

the real question is, which do YOU think LOOKS best?
if the vts is better condition than the other then id sway towards that tbh as its less work to get it how you want it
